Maguindanao canvassing suspended

May. 22, 2007

The canvassing of votes from Maguindanao, the province at the center of a controversy allegedly involving massive election fraud, has been suspended by the National Board of Canvassers. The board cited as reason for the suspension the fact that the election supervisor for the province has been absent during the canvassing.

The administration Team Unity has recently claimed a 12-0 sweep in the senatorial race in the province. This claim, however, has been disputed by testimonies, mostly to election watchdogs and the media, that teachers and even children were used to manufacture the votes in Maguindanao in the middle of the night, under the guard of soldiers.
